On average across the year,
Canarsie, New York is approximately as hot as
Cypress Hills, New York
.
Canarsie, New York has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F and Cypress Hills, New York has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Canarsie, New York's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Cypress Hills, New York's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, Canarsie, New York is approximately as cold as Cypress Hills, New York . Canarsie, New York has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F and Cypress Hills, New York has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.

Yes, Canarsie is more populated than Cypress Hills.
Canarsie has a population of 87,366 and Cypress Hills has a population of 54,944
which means that Canarsie has 32,422 more people than Cypress Hills.
That makes Canarsie 2 times more populated than Cypress Hills.
